Why You Can’t Afford to “Wing It”

Even the most meticulously planned shipment can run into a “life happens” moment. Without a solid strategy, your business is on the hook for the full cost of any mishaps. Insurance steps in to act as a shield for the lifeline of your business, covering:

  • Vanishing Acts: Protection against loss or theft while your goods are in transit.
  • Gravity & Weather: Coverage for damage caused by rough handling, storms, or accidents.
  • The “Waiting Game”: Compensation for financial losses that stem from significant delays.
  • Legal Red Tape: Support during customs or legal disputes in the event of a claim.

Choosing Your Shield

Not every journey requires the same level of armor. We help you choose the fit that best suits your current mission:

  • All-Risk Coverage: The “VIP” treatment. It provides comprehensive protection against most risks and is a must-have for high-value goods.
  • Named Perils: A more budget-friendly option that covers specific risks explicitly listed in your policy—great for lower-risk shipments.
  • Carrier Limits: A word of caution—standard carrier coverage is often like a tiny umbrella in a monsoon; it rarely covers the full value of your cargo.

Understanding your shipment’s value and the level of risk involved helps determine the right type of insurance for your business.
